§ 23-14-68-3 — Maintenance of cemeteries

Indiana·Title 23 BUSINESS AND OTHER ASSOCIATIONS·Art. 14 CEMETERY ASSOCIATIONS·Ch. 68 Care of Cemeteries by Townships

For the purposes of this chapter, the maintenance of a cemetery includes the following:

(1)Resetting and straightening all monuments.
(2)Leveling and seeding the ground.
(3)Constructing fences where there are none and repairing existing fences.
(4)Destroying and cleaning up detrimental plants (as defined in IC 15-16-8-1), rampant weeds, and rank vegetation.
(5)Mowing the lawn.

Legislative History

As added by P.L.52-1997, SEC.42. Amended by P.L.2-2008, SEC.48; P.L.14-2018, SEC.9; P.L.162-2021, SEC.8.
